This revised edition provides a comprehensive view of the thematic structure of Wilson's plays, the placement of his work within the context of American drama, and the distinctively African American experiences and traditions that he dramatizes. It includes a revised introduction, revised chapters, and material from interviews with seminal figures in Wilson's personal and professional life.
